Proto® TorquePlus™ Combination Wrench, Anti-Slip Design, Measurement System: Imperial, Spline Wrench, 1-1/16 in Wrench Opening, 12 Points, 15-1/4 in Overall Length, 15 deg Offset, 2-9/64 in Open End Width, 15/32 in Open End Thickness, 1-31/64 in Box End Width, 5/8 in Box End Thickness, 15 deg Head, ASME B107.100 Specifications Met, 1-9/32 in Throat Depth, Alloy Steel, Black Oxide
  • Non-reflective black oxide finish for use where non-plated products are required
  • 12 point box end allows for fine indexing, helping to improve speed and access
  • Fits 4, 6 and 12 point fasteners
  • The box end is countersunk for easy application to the fastener
  • 15 deg angled offset box end keeps wrench clear of obstructions
  • Anti-slip design (ASD) open end
  • Sizes 1-5/16 in and larger do not have ASD feature
  • Box ends incorporate the TorquePlus™ system
  • Locking groove to help prevent slippage
  • Arched surface which spreads the force over a 400% larger contact area to help prolong life
  • No ribs or serrations to damage fasteners
  • Allows upto 15% more torque to be applied to the fastener
  • Reduces risk of fastener rounding
  • Provides a better grip on worn, rounded fasteners
